Title Insurance Explained


Title insurance is essential for most Florida real estate transactions. It protects against:

Defective titles

Unpaid liens

Errors in public records

Fraudulent claims

Without title insurance, buyers and lenders risk financial loss if a title problem surfaces after closing. Our office provides title insurance through Old Republic Title Insurance, Inc., a trusted name in the industry.

Why Title Insurance Matters


Imagine buying a home only to discover an old lien or a missing signature in the chain of title. These issues can cost thousands to fix. Title insurance covers these risks, giving you confidence that your ownership is secure.

Key Advantages:

  • One-time premium for lifetime coverage
  • Protection for both buyer and lender
  • Legal defense against title claims

Common Questions About Real Estate Closings

  • Do I need an attorney for a closing?

    While not required, having an attorney ensures legal compliance and protects your interests.

  • What does title insurance cover?

    It covers defects, liens, and claims that could affect ownership.

  • How long does a closing take?

    Most closings take 30–45 days, depending on lender requirements and title searches.

  • Can you handle mobile home transactions?

    Yes. We manage title transfers and closings for mobile homes.
